TALLAHASSEE – Gov. Ron DeSantis has signed into regulation a measure that proceeds attempts to tackle pink tide outbreaks in Florida waters.

The evaluate extends the Florida Purple Tide Mitigation and Technology Development Initiative, which was developed in 2019 and was established to expire subsequent calendar year. It also phone calls for the condition Division of Environmental Security to expedite regulatory evaluations of lab endeavours and industry trials carried out to manage and mitigate purple tide alongside the shoreline.

“We have things in Lake Okeechobee, on some of the algae blooms, that if you do it, it does handle the algae blooms very proficiently,” DeSantis reported throughout a bill signing function at Florida Gulf Coastline University’s Kapnick Education and Research Center in Naples on Tuesday. “We want to get to the same level the place we are equipped to do that with red tide.”

The initiative is a partnership concerning the Fish and Wildlife Exploration Institute and Mote Marine Laboratory. The measure also needs the Department of Environmental Protection to simplicity polices and permitting processes that could slow Mote’s purple-tide mitigation efforts.

DeSantis on Tuesday also explained he does not intend to veto funds incorporated in the state funds for the 2024-2025 fiscal 12 months supposed to deal with red tide. The funds, which DeSantis has not nevertheless obtained from the Legislature, involves $20 million for efforts to fight algal blooms and $22 million for crimson tide study.
